Kastellet (The Copenhagen Citadel)

Highlight • Historical Site

The Kastellet is one of the best-preserved fortifications in the city of Copenhagen. The structure is in the shape of a five-pointed star, with bastions at its points. In addition to military facilities, it houses a church and a windmill.
Although the Kastellet is still used by the Danish military, it now primarily serves as a destination for excursions and a local recreation area. It is located in the northeast of the city not far from Østerport station and is served by bus lines 15, 19, 26, and 1A.
Admission is free; the Kastellet is open daily from 6 a.m. until sunset. The grounds include a natural park, which is also extensively used by the residents of Copenhagen and is home to numerous animals.
Two smaller museums are also located within the complex. A military ceremony for the changing of the guard takes place daily at 12 p.m. In the summer, concerts with military music are held at 2 p.m., which are also worth attending.

Equestrian Statue of Frederick V

Highlight • Monument

In the middle of Amalienborg Palace Square is a monumental equestrian statue showing Frederik V, who was King of Denmark and Norway, Duke of Schleswig and Holstein and Count of Oldenburg and Delmenhorst from 1746 until his death in 1766.
